My rating: 3 of 5 stars
Yet another in the sequence of books filling in the gap between Star Trek: Insurrection and Nemesis.
But an interesting story line about genetic nature vs. environmental influences (here, biology--think the episode "This Side of Paradise" of the original series, though more elegant than plants with a tendency to behave like they are a shotgun), family dynamics, and urban warfare. Oh, and a deep thread of suspicious activity at Starfleet Command. Yes, boys and girls, this is after the Dominion War, and the flavor is much more Deep Space Nine than the sunlight and high-mindedness of the first two series.
Not the best ST novel I've read (which would be Fallen Heroes), but also not the worst (too many contenders).
